Today had another session with w34z3l and am very satisfied with how it went because get some encouragement for keeping up. Don't have the recording yet, but some of conclusions are following:
I have to defend more to 3bets. I have to expand both cold calling ranges and 4betting ranges.
I have to raise flop cbets more. I'm defending sufficient enough, but mostly passively. What I need to do is just add some hands to raising range, especially OOP.
I should cold call more on every position, especially BB. We discussed my constructed ranges on the BB and I will change them as soon I'll get the recording.
I should reduce the turn cbet percentage. Seems that I 2barrel too often.
Other stats are relatively ok. We didn't discuss it, but I think have one leak more:
I should fold to turn cbets less.
If I fix all those leaks, I'm pretty sure that will be ready for NL10/NL25. So, I decided to take a time to work on those. I have learning material and willingness to learn and I will do it!
